I would talk to your manager again and calmly tell him that the bullying has not stopped and has gotten worse.  It is hard on you and ask him if you should take it to a higher manager?  Do not threaten.  be civil, be calm. Perhaps make a record of what and when before you go into the office.  That will give you credibility.  When you can show examples it will help you not to fumble for words and tell him exactly what was done/said and when.  Also calmly tell him that you enjoy your work and want to do your best. Remind him that there are laws that do not allow bullying in the workplace.
